什么是Shadowsocks?
Shadowsocks是一种开源代理工具,广泛用于科学上网。它的设计初衷是为了解决网络审查问题,提供安全、快速的网络访问。由于其灵活性和安全性,Shadowsocks被许多人使用。
什么是AES 256 CFB?
AES(高级加密标准)是一种广泛使用的对称加密算法。它的256位密钥长度被认为是非常安全的。CFB(Cipher Feedback)模式是一种加密模式,允许以流的形式进行加密。这种模式在某些情况下比块加密模式更有效。
Shadowsocks中的AES 256 CFB安全性分析
AES 256加密算法的强度
- 强度:AES 256比AES 128和AES 192更强,抵御暴力破解攻击的时间更长。
- 广泛应用:AES已经被广泛应用于政府和金融机构等安全性要求极高的领域。
CFB模式的特点
- 数据流处理:CFB模式允许数据流的逐块处理,减少了延迟。
- 错误传播:CFB模式的错误传播较小,一旦发生错误,仅会影响到当前块,而不会影响到整个数据流。
Shadowsocks中的使用场景
- 科学上网:在某些国家和地区,用户使用Shadowsocks来翻越防火墙,访问被封锁的网站。
- 保护隐私:Shadowsocks可以隐藏用户的真实IP地址,增加网络隐私。
Shadowsocks AES 256 CFB的安全风险
虽然Shadowsocks和AES 256 CFB在安全性上都有很强的表现,但依然存在一些潜在的安全风险。
密钥管理
- 密钥泄露:如果AES密钥被攻击者获取,则所有通过该密钥加密的数据都会暴露。
- 定期更换密钥:建议定期更换密钥,增加攻击者破解的难度。
配置错误
- 错误配置:如果Shadowsocks的配置不当,可能导致安全漏洞。
- 及时更新:保持Shadowsocks和相关软件的更新,防止已知漏洞被利用。
运营环境
- 服务器安全:即使加密很强,如果服务器本身不安全,数据仍然会被窃取。
- 安全审计:建议定期进行安全审计,发现并修复潜在的安全隐患。
如何增强Shadowsocks的安全性
- 使用最新版本:确保使用最新版本的Shadowsocks,以利用最新的安全更新。
- 强密码:使用强密码来增强访问控制。
- 启用二次验证:增加额外的安全层,确保只有授权用户可以访问。
常见问题解答(FAQ)
Shadowsocks AES 256 CFB安全吗?
Shadowsocks AES 256 CFB具有较高的安全性,使用AES 256加密和CFB模式,可以有效抵御大多数攻击。不过,密钥管理和服务器安全也非常重要。
使用Shadowsocks时需要注意什么?
在使用Shadowsocks时,注意以下几点:
- 选择安全的服务器。
- 定期更换密钥。
- 保持软件更新。
Shadowsocks与VPN有什么区别?
- 速度:Shadowsocks通常比传统VPN速度更快。
- 加密方式:Shadowsocks使用的加密方式更为灵活,可以选择不同的加密算法。
如何选择合适的加密算法?
选择合适的加密算法时,考虑以下因素:
- 安全性:选择经过验证的加密算法,如AES。
- 性能:不同的加密算法在性能上有差异,选择适合自己需求的算法。
如何配置Shadowsocks以提高安全性?
- 使用强密码。
- 启用加密。
- 配置防火墙规则,限制访问权限。
结论
Shadowsocks AES 256 CFB是一种安全性较高的加密方式,适合需要保护隐私和绕过网络限制的用户。然而,安全的使用离不开合理的配置和良好的密钥管理。用户在享受其便利的同时,也要注意潜在的安全隐患。
正文完